Guests at Nailcote Hall event help fund state-of-the-art equipment for hospitals
A Pink Ball at Nailcote Hall Hotel Golf and Country Club raised £8,000 for state-of-the-art cancer treatment at local hospitals. The event, organised by the hotel’s co-owner and two-time cancer survivor Sue Cressman, welcomed 225 guests – including TV actor Christopher Walker, best known for his roles in BBC’s Doctors and drama Merseybeat, and musician Andy Kyriacou of the band Modern Romance. Cash raised will help fund a multi-purpose bed for breast cancer patients at Solihull Hospital and specialist hi-tech equipment at University Hospitals Coventry and Warwickshire.
